Frequently Asked Questions about Patchogue
How much are Studio apartments in Patchogue?
There are currently 26 Studio Apartments in Patchogue with rent ranges from $1,925 to $2,423 with an average price of $2,162.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Patchogue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Patchogue ranges from $1,960 to $3,527 with an average monthly rent of $2,589.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Patchogue c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Patchogue range from $2,600 to $4,360.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,188.
How expensive are Patchogue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 8 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Patchogue on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,640 to $5,036 - averaging $3,888 for the location.
